About this experience
Experience the breathtaking beauty of the Amalfi Coast with our private tour in a Mercedes van accompanied by an English-speaking driver. Whether you're vacationing in Naples or arriving via cruise, join us as we explore the picturesque towns of Positano, Amalfi, and Ravello. Your adventure begins in Naples, where our driver will pick you up from the port, train station, airport, or your accommodation. First, embark on a journey through the charming village of Positano, renowned for its stunning vistas and fashionable boutiques. Next, venture to the historic town of Amalfi, where you can marvel at the ancient Saint Andrew’s Cathedral and savor delicious local cuisine. After lunch, ascend to Ravello, celebrated for its artistic legacy and breathtaking villas, offering panoramic views of the sea. Relax as our reliable driver chauffeurs you back to Naples and enjoy these stunning views once more. Immerse yourself in the beauty and culture of this enchanting region with us.

What you'll see and do
Naples
Be picked up by our English-speaking driver. Meet at the designated location, whether it's the port, train station, airport, or your accommodation.
30 minutes here
Amalfi Coast
Enjoy a scenic drive along the Amalfi Coast, admiring the stunning views of the Mediterranean Sea and the dramatic coastline.
60 minutes here
Positano
Arrive in the charming village of Positano, famous for its colorful buildings cascading down the hillside. Explore the picturesque streets and take in the beauty of Spiaggia Grande, Positano's main beach.
60 minutes here
Spiaggia di Positano Marina Grande
Relax on Spiaggia Grande, soaking up the sun and enjoying the serene atmosphere of this beautiful beach.
60 minutes here
Amalfi
Continue your journey to the historic town of Amalfi, the heart of the Amalfi Coast.
60 minutes here
Duomo di Sant'Andrea
Visit the impressive Duomo di Amalfi, a stunning cathedral dating back to the 9th century.
60 minutes here · Admission not included
Ravello
Ascend to the hilltop town of Ravello, known for its panoramic views and serene atmosphere.
60 minutes here
Villa Cimbrone Gardens
Explore the enchanting Villa Rufolo and Villa Cimbrone, both offering breathtaking vistas over the coastline.
30 minutes here · Admission not included
Naples
After a full day of exploration, relax as your driver chauffeurs you back to Naples.
60 minutes here
